A body of mass 100 kg is suspended by a spring of stiffness of 30 Kn/m and dashpot of damping constant 1000 N s/m. Vibration is excited by a harmonic force of amplitude 80 N and a frequency of 3 Hz.

Calculate the amplitude of the displacement for the vibration and the phase angle between the displacement and the excitation force using the graphical method
